This episode will cover Canada's most popular and well documented UFO encounter. On May 20,1967, Stefan Michalak witnessed something that would change his life and continue to affect him and his family for decades to come. The majority of the researc... more

It is safe to say that most have heard of the Bermuda Triangle, but have you heard of the Nevada Triangle? It's an area in America that stretches across part of the Sierra Nevada, where on average 3 planes go missing every month. What about the Michi... more
